CVE-2022-32947: The issue was addressed with improved memory handling.

The issue was addressed with improved memory handling. This issue is fixed in iOS 16.1 and iPadOS 16, macOS Ventura 13, watchOS 9.1. An app may be able to execute arbitrary code with kernel privileges.

Plain-English summary

This Apple kernel vulnerability could let a malicious app gain deep system control if a user interacts with it. Apple says the issue was fixed through improved memory handling in listed OS updates. Treat unpatched Apple devices as higher-risk because kernel privileges can expose data, integrity, and availability.

Executive priority

Prioritize remediation for managed Apple fleets, especially executive, developer, and privileged-user devices. The issue is not presented as actively exploited in the supplied sources, but kernel code execution potential justifies timely patching.

Technical view

CVE-2022-32947 is a CWE-787 memory handling issue. The CVSS 3.1 vector is local, low complexity, no privileges required, user interaction required, with high confidentiality, integrity, and availability impact. Apple states an app may execute arbitrary code with kernel privileges.

Likely exposure

Exposure likely applies to Apple devices covered by the advisories that are below iOS 16.1, iPadOS 16, macOS Ventura 13, or watchOS 9.1. The supplied affected-version data is incomplete and lists unspecified Apple versions.

Exploitation context

The source bundle does not show CISA KEV listing or other cited evidence of active exploitation. The described attack path requires local app execution and user interaction, not a remote unauthenticated network exploit.

Researcher notes

Key constraints are local attack vector and required user interaction. The bundle does not identify the specific vulnerable component, affected version ranges, or exploit activity. Avoid assuming unsupported Apple platforms are affected beyond the cited advisories.

Mitigation direction

  • Update iOS devices to iOS 16.1 or later where applicable.
  • Update iPadOS devices to iPadOS 16 or later where applicable.
  • Update Macs to macOS Ventura 13 or later where applicable.
  • Update Apple Watch devices to watchOS 9.1 or later where applicable.
  • Check Apple advisories for device-specific applicability and any later superseding fixes.

Validation and detection

  • Inventory Apple devices and record OS versions.
  • Compare versions against Apple’s fixed releases for this CVE.
  • Confirm update status through MDM, EDR, or device settings.
  • Prioritize devices allowing unmanaged application installation.
  • Document exceptions where hardware cannot receive the fixed release.
